引言
随着全球气候变化和人类活动的影响,自然灾害的频发和严重程度不断上升。灾害防御已成为各国政府和社会各界关注的焦点。本文将深入探讨灾害防御的新策略,分析关键措施,以期为我国灾害防御工作提供参考。
灾害防御新策略概述
1. 预警与监测
灾害防御的首要任务是预警与监测。通过利用现代科技手段,如遥感、卫星、气象雷达等,实现对灾害的实时监测和预警。
2. 应急管理体系
建立健全的应急管理体系,明确各级政府、各部门、各单位的职责和任务,提高灾害应对能力。
3. 综合防御体系
构建综合防御体系,包括工程防御、非工程防御和社区防御,实现多层次、多角度的灾害防御。
4. 社会参与
广泛动员社会力量参与灾害防御,提高全民防灾减灾意识。
关键措施深度研究
1. 预警与监测
a. 遥感技术
遥感技术可以实现对灾害的实时监测,如洪水、地震、台风等。以下是一个使用Python编程语言进行遥感图像处理的示例代码:
from osgeo import gdal
import numpy as np
def load_raster(image_path):
dataset = gdal.Open(image_path)
band = dataset.GetRasterBand(1)
data = band.ReadAsArray()
return data
def process_raster(data):
# 对遥感图像进行预处理
processed_data = np.where(data > 0, 1, 0)
return processed_data
if __name__ == '__main__':
image_path = 'path_to_image.tif'
data = load_raster(image_path)
processed_data = process_raster(data)
print(processed_data)
b. 卫星技术
卫星技术可以提供全球范围内的灾害监测数据。以下是一个使用Python编程语言进行卫星图像处理的示例代码:
import geopandas as gpd
from rasterio.plot import show
from rasterio.transform import from_origin
def load_satellite_image(image_path):
dataset = gdal.Open(image_path)
band = dataset.GetRasterBand(1)
data = band.ReadAsArray()
transform = dataset.GetTransform()
return data, transform
def plot_satellite_image(data, transform):
gdf = gpd.GeoDataFrame.from_numpy(data)
gdf['geometry'] = gpd.points_from_xy(gdf[:, 0], gdf[:, 1])
ax = gpd.plotting.plot_geos(gdf, ax=None)
show(ax)
if __name__ == '__main__':
image_path = 'path_to_image.tif'
data, transform = load_satellite_image(image_path)
plot_satellite_image(data, transform)
2. 应急管理体系
a. 职责明确
明确各级政府、各部门、各单位的职责和任务,确保灾害发生时能够迅速响应。
b. 应急预案
制定详细的应急预案,包括灾害预警、应急响应、灾后重建等环节。
c. 人员培训
定期组织应急管理人员和救援队伍进行培训,提高应对灾害的能力。
3. 综合防御体系
a. 工程防御
加强工程设施建设,如防洪堤、水库、地震监测站等。
b. 非工程防御
加强非工程防御措施,如制定灾害风险评估、灾害保险、灾后重建规划等。
c. 社区防御
提高社区居民的防灾减灾意识,开展应急演练,提高自救互救能力。
4. 社会参与
a. 宣传教育
通过媒体、网络等渠道开展宣传教育,提高全民防灾减灾意识。
b. 志愿者服务
组织志愿者参与灾害救援和灾后重建工作。
总结
灾害防御是一项系统工程,需要政府、社会、企业和个人的共同努力。通过深入研究和实施新的防御策略和关键措施,可以有效降低灾害风险,保障人民群众的生命财产安全。